AMENDMENT No. 3 TO FACILITIES USE/REVOCABLE LICENSE AGREEMENT 
BETWEEN 
TEMPE UNION HIGH SCHOOL DISTRICT NO. 213   
AND  
MARICOPA COUNTY 
 
RECITALS 
 
A. 
This Amendment No. 3 (“Amendment”) to that certain Facilities Use/Revocable License 
Agreement No. P-50308 dated June 14, 2017 and subsequently amended June 26, 2019, 
and June 23, 2021 (collectively, “Agreement”) is made and entered into by and between 
Maricopa County, a political subdivision of the State of Arizona (“Licensee”) and the 
Tempe Union High School District No. 213, a political subdivision of the State of Arizona 
(“Licensor”), (collectively, “Parties”). The Agreement is for premises located at 500 West 
Guadalupe Road, Tempe, AZ 85283 (“Property”), consisting of two classrooms, 
playground space, and meeting/common area on the Property (“Premises”) for Early Head 
Start Program use. 
 
B. 
The term of the Agreement, as amended, expires on June 30, 2022. 
 
C. 
The Parties now mutually desire to enter into this Amendment to amend the Agreement to: 
(A) extend term; (B) provide renewal option; (C) update termination language; (D) approve 
certain Licensee tenant improvements; and (E) renew counterpart language.

EXHIBIT “A” 
 
Tenant Improvements 
 
Program: Maricopa County Human Services Department – Early Education Division 
Project Request # 21-223 – Tempe Union High School District No. 213 
 
 
Project description: 
• 
Remove and Replace 1211 square feet of artificial turf 
• 
Remove and Replace 1390 square feet of Pour-N-Play  
• 
Install weep holes in masonry wall for drainage 
 
Project Budget:   
 
Not to exceed $120,000
